Q: How is the user-profile store sharded, and what protects cross-shard rebalancing? A: ProfileVault splits profiles across 64 shards by hashed account key; rebalancing requires dual approval and runs only from the sealed migration host. If a reviewer must audit a live rebalance, the migration console is unlocked with the passphrase below.

vault phrase of taweg-kafof = oliax-zorael

## Incremental Rebuilds — Lanternpress

Lanternpress rebuilds only pages whose content hashes changed since the last publish. Review PRs for anything that touches the hash manifest; a stale manifest forces a full rebuild and blocks the deploy queue. Rebuild triggers come from the Stonewick CMS webhook, which must authenticate. The builder's env file therefore needs this line:

sealed setting: LEDGER_TOKEN5=bcca1

The Coalescer sidecar's integration stage on the Mirrowbank CI fleet has been failing intermittently since the runner image update. Root cause: the sidecar binds its admin port before the mock scrape target is ready, so the health probe races and fails roughly one run in five. Adding a readiness wait in the test harness resolves it. The last known-good image carries the token below.

trace token, kahog-tajeg: htk6_97d963

Welcome aboard! Quick context for Thursday's sync: we're splitting the Pellwick profile store into sixteen shards keyed on account region. The migration runner (codename Driftgate) copies rows in batches and verifies checksums before flipping reads. Don't kick off a shard move without pinging the on-call first — rebalances during peak traffic have bitten us twice. To run Driftgate locally against the staging cluster, you'll need credentials for the Hollowbrim coordination service. Use the key that follows for all staging shard operations.

API key for yahig-tadup: kto7_ubizbYm

Quarterly Planning Note — Board of Varnell Instruments

Warranty costs on the Peltram 40 line ran 18% above forecast this quarter, driven by a seal defect in early production batches. Remediation is underway and supplier terms are being renegotiated. Reserves have been adjusted accordingly. The related commercial response is summarized confidentially below.

board note of baguf-fafog: Kasixox Foods plans to lower the Drueth list price by 48 percent in March.